    <description>The Appellate Tribunal ITAT Jabalpur allowed the appeal against the penalty imposed under section 271(1)(A) by the ITO, which was confirmed by the AAC. The Tribunal found that there was sufficient cause to cancel the penalty due to doubts about the alleged default in filing the return for the assessment year 1970-71. The decision was based on the examination of circumstantial evidence and the absence of documented proof of filing, leading to the conclusion that the penalty was not warranted in this case.</description>
